Is It Illegal to Spit on the Sidewalk in California?

In California, it is considered illegal to spit on the sidewalk in most cities and counties. This is due to public health concerns and the potential spread of diseases through saliva. Violators can face fines or even more serious consequences depending on local ordinances and regulations.

Can you get fined for spitting on the sidewalk in California?

Yes, you can get fined for spitting on the sidewalk in California. Many cities and counties have ordinances in place that prohibit spitting in public areas to maintain cleanliness and prevent the spread of diseases. Violators may face fines ranging from $25 to $500 depending on the location and circumstances.

What are the public health reasons for banning spitting on the sidewalk?

Spitting on the sidewalk can spread diseases such as tuberculosis, influenza, and even COVID-19. The saliva expelled when someone spits can contain bacteria and viruses that can be harmful to others. By prohibiting spitting in public spaces, California aims to protect the health of its residents and visitors.
